What Growing Fleets Should Expect from a Telematics Partner

As fleets grow, so do the challenges that come with managing them.

More vehicles mean more data, more drivers, more compliance requirements, and more operational complexity. While telematics technology can help manage this growth, the effectiveness of that technology depends heavily on the support behind it.

Choosing a telematics provider isn’t just about features—it’s about partnership.

Beyond Hardware and Software

Many fleets initially focus on hardware specifications and software capabilities when selecting a provider.

While these are important, they are only part of the equation.

Without proper implementation, training, and ongoing support, even the most advanced system can fall short.

A strong telematics partner helps ensure that the technology is not only installed—but actually used effectively.

Implementation That Sets You Up for Success

The onboarding process is critical.

A good partner will guide you through:

  • Device installation
  • System setup
  • Platform configuration
  • Driver onboarding

This ensures that your system is aligned with your operational goals from the beginning.

Poor implementation often leads to underutilization, where fleets have the tools—but aren’t using them to their full potential.

Ongoing Support and Training

Telematics is not a “set it and forget it” solution.

As your fleet grows, your needs evolve.

A reliable partner provides ongoing support, including:

  • Training for new team members
  • Updates on new features and capabilities
  • Assistance with interpreting data
  • Recommendations for improving performance

This ongoing relationship is what turns a tool into a long-term solution.
